Yarn Quality and Variety

Quality and variety form the foundation of a successful yarn shopping experience, especially when you’re browsing online stores where you can’t physically touch the fibers. Look for retailers offering diverse materials—from 100% polyester and acrylic to luxurious merino wool—to match your project requirements. Detailed specifications matter: check for clear yarn weight classifications like CYC #4 medium or CYC #6 super bulky to guarantee compatibility with your patterns.

You’ll want stores featuring multiple colorways and textures, including self-striping yarns and pastel palettes that elevate your creations. Prioritize easy-care options with straightforward washing instructions, like machine washability and low-temperature drying. Finally, review customer feedback on softness, durability, and resistance to fraying or pilling—these factors directly influence your finished project’s quality.

Price and Value Comparison

Finding the perfect yarn means little if it strains your budget or delivers poor value. You’ll want to compare unit prices per yard, since longer skeins over 200 yards often provide better value for larger projects. Don’t overlook pack sizes—multi-pack purchases typically cost less per skein than individual ones.

Factor in shipping costs when comparing stores. Higher-priced yarn with free shipping can sometimes beat cheaper options with hefty delivery fees. Look for discounts, promotions, and loyalty programs that enhance your purchasing power.

Read customer reviews carefully about yarn quality. That bargain-priced skein might lack the softness or durability you need, ultimately costing you more in replacements. Balance price against quality to guarantee you’re getting genuine value.

Care Instructions Provided

Clear care instructions protect your investment and guarantee your finished projects maintain their beauty through years of use. When selecting an online yarn store, prioritize retailers that provide detailed washing and maintenance guidelines for each yarn type.

Different fibers demand specific care approaches. Wool and delicate blends typically require hand washing and air drying, while acrylic yarns usually tolerate machine washing and tumble drying. You’ll find some fibers resist fading and shrinking, whereas others prove more susceptible to damage under improper conditions.

Look for stores that specify water temperatures, drying methods, and whether bleach should be avoided. These details directly impact your project’s longevity through multiple washes and regular use. Complete care information helps you make informed purchasing decisions based on your lifestyle and maintenance preferences.
